What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Christchurch to Kathmandu?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Christchurch to Kathmandu cl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

When flying from Christchurch to Kathmandu, you should consider leaving on a Sunday and avoid Thursdays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Christchurch, you’ll find the best rates on Fridays and the most expensive ones on Thursdays.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Christchurch to Kathmandu?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Christchurch to Kathmandu,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Christchurch to Kathmandu is July, where tickets cost $1,723 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and June,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$2,610 and $2,403 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Christchurch to Kathmandu?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Christchurch to Kathmandu,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Christchurch to Kathmandu, you should book around 7 weeks before departure, which saves you about 27%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 15 weeks before departure.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Christchurch to Kathmandu?

    Christchurch and Kathmandu are both served by 1 main airport. You will leave Christchurch from Christchurch and will be arriving at Kathmandu Tribhuvan.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Christchurch to Kathmandu?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to Kathmandu with an airline and back to Christchurch with another airline.
